fzy

terminal fuzzy finder picker

git clone https://9o.is/git/fzy.git

commit 318e291dac53a48423346f8bb7c1018256bbb6c4
parent 3d127e4a44af9c50c0c0695a35dfa2fc3457f317
Author: Jason Felice <jason.m.felice@gmail.com>
Date:   Fri,  4 May 2018 11:42:34 -0400

Initialize fd_set correctly

Diffstat:
Msrc/tty.c | 1+
1 file changed, 1 insertion(+), 0 deletions(-)

diff --git a/src/tty.c b/src/tty.c @@ -90,6 +90,7 @@ char tty_getchar(tty_t *tty) { int tty_input_ready(tty_t *tty) { fd_set readfs; struct timeval tv = {0, 0}; + FD_ZERO(&readfs); FD_SET(tty->fdin, &readfs); select(tty->fdin + 1, &readfs, NULL, NULL, &tv); return FD_ISSET(tty->fdin, &readfs);